Log:
Created two new frame order system tests for the free rotor isotropic cone PDB
representation file.
This is the two PDB files from the frame_order.pdb_model user function. The
two new system tests
are Frame_order.test_pdb_model_iso_cone_free_rotor_z_axis and
Frame_order.test_pdb_model_iso_cone_free_rotor_xz_plane_tilt.
